This months featured showman is Kadyn Braaten. Kadyn is a sophomore in highschool from Townsend, Montana. She loves to show at Montana State Fair and the NILE, and has 2 siblings- Spencer and Trenton. Read below to find out more about her and her livestock showing journey!
Montana Ag: What species do you show and which is your favorite?
Kadyn: I show pigs, hiefers, steers and lambs. My favorite is pigs by far.

Montana Ag: What is your most memorable stock show moment?
Kadyn: I cannot pick just 1 single moment, my years of showing livestock have been amazing. I’ve been able to travel to many different places with my family, meet so many great people, build friendships that will last a lifetime, and make memories I will be able to cherish forever. Some of my top memories would definitely be showing at the World Pork Expo in Des Moines, IA with my family this past summer, watching my little brother win the NILE in 2017, and sharing countless laughs while I spend tons of time with all my friends at stock shows.

Montana Ag: What do you consider your biggest showing accomplishment?
Kadyn: I think my biggest showing accomplishment would have to be getting a callback at World Pork Expo last summer. Either that or having Reserve Champion senior hog showman at the MT state fair last August.
Montana Ag: Outside of showing livestock, what other hobbies do you enjoy?
Kadyn: When I’m not showing, I enjoy livestock judging, being involved in my FFA chapter and 4-H club, playing basketball, skiing, and raising show hogs with my family.

Montana Ag: What is one piece of advice you would offer to other kids in the barn?
Kadyn: Be kind, work hard, stay humble, and enjoy every minute of it.
